Job description

Architectural Technologist

Location: Guildford

Salary: £32000-£40000 (dependent on experience)

A well-established, design-focused architectural practice in Guildford is seeking a talented and proactive Architectural Technologist to join its growing team. This RIBA-chartered firm is widely respected for delivering high-quality projects across the commercial, residential, retail, and education sectors. With a strong commitment to technical excellence and innovation, the studio fosters a collaborative, forward-thinking working environment.

The Role

The successful candidate will have proven experience in the retail sector and a confident ability to manage projects across all RIBA work stages. You will be responsible for producing technically robust, regulation-compliant solutions while maintaining close communication with clients, consultants, and contractors throughout the process.

Key Responsibilities

Produce detailed technical drawings and specifications in collaboration with the design team

Lead projects from concept through to completion, including on-site coordination

Ensure compliance with UK building regulations and industry standards

Conduct regular site visits to monitor progress and uphold design intent

Prepare planning applications and building control documentation

Work closely with architects, engineers and external consultants to deliver cohesive solutions

Requirements

Degree (or equivalent) in Architectural Technology

Strong knowledge of UK building regulations, detailing, and construction materials

Demonstrable experience delivering retail projects in a UK-based practice

Excellent attention to detail and problem-solving ability

Strong communication and organisational skills, with the ability to manage multiple deadlines

High proficiency in Revit (essential)
